JCT Design & Build 2016 released

26 October 2016

The Joint Contracts Tribunal (JCT) has now launched the 2016 Design and Build Contract form. It follows on the tails of the release in June of the 2016 editions of the Minor Works Building Contract and the Short Form Subcontracts in July 2016. To coincide with the launch of the 2016 Design and Build Contract, back-to-back changes have also been made in relation to the Design and Build Subcontract Agreement and Conditions Forms.

Article IV Rule 5 of the Hague

18 October 2016

On Friday, the Commercial Court, in the case of Vinnlustodin HF and another -v- Sea Tank Shipping AS (The AQASIA) settled a 92-year-old debate, by finding that the limit of liability under Article IV rule 5 of the Hague Rules does not apply to bulk cargo.

Court of Appeal decides obligation to pay hire is not a condition

13 October 2016

In a decision handed down on 7 October 2016, the Court of Appeal upheld the judgment of Popplewell J. at first instance and concluded that payment of hire by charterers was not a condition of the charterparty (Grand China Logistics Holding (Group) Co. Ltd -v- Spar Shipping AS [2016] EWCA Civ 982).
